ONS-2014-147 November 14, 2014 Page 2 Ladies and Gentlemen, Duke Energy submitted the Seismic Hazard and Screening Report for Oconee Nuclear Station (ONS) on March 31, 2014 (Reference 6) pursuant to the NRC's 10 CFR 50.54(0 request (Reference 1). The report was based on industry guidance and an industry approach (References 2 and 4) which had been reviewed and accepted by the NRC (References 3 and 5). The report required necessary changes to be made to the Central and Eastern United States Seismic Source Characterization for Nuclear Facilities (CEUS-SSC) catalog, and the NRC was provided a detailed description of the changes by EPRI (Reference 7).

By letter dated October 23, 2014 (Reference 8), the NRC submitted a Request for Additional Information (RAI) related to the CEUS-SSC changes, which they characterized as a regional update. Enclosure 1 to this letter provides Duke Energy's response to the NRC's RAI for Oconee Nuclear Station Units 1, 2, and 3. The response provides the information which is currently available and establishes a proposed date of April 30, 2015 for submitting the results of a formal study of the CEUS-SSC Catalog regional update.

Oconee Nuclear Station Response Duke Energy will exercise the proposed alternate response provided in the RAI for Oconee. Duke Energy will credit a SSHAC Level 2' study of the updated Regional CEUS-SSC Catalog and expects to submit the results to the NRC by April 30, 2015.

The SSHAC study will be performed by EPRI and will assess if the CEUS-SSC Catalog regional update, used for the Recommendation 2.1, Seismic Hazard Reevaluation, represents the center, body, and range of technically defensible interpretations.

The RAI above includes the following petition:

In addition to providing a detailed descriptionof the catalog update, please describe the scope of the update and whether you also considered the impact of earthquakes in the region since the time period covered by the CEUS-SSC Catalog.

The decision to perform a catalog update was based on the NRC statement contained in the February 15, 2013 letter (ADAMS Accession No. ML12319A074), that endorsed the SPID guidance. In that letter the NRC stated, in part, the following:

If... new information were to emerge during the reevaluationperiod that could require an update of the CEUS-SSC model, the staff expects licensees to evaluate the significance of the new information to determine if the CEUS-SSC model needs to be updated in order to appropriatelyrespond to the 50.54(o request.

Enclosure - ONS Seismic Catalog RAI Response ONS-2014-147 November 14, 2014 A detailed description of the CEUS-SSC Catalog regional update was submitted to the NRC by EPRI in a letter dated August 28, 2014 (ADAMS Accession No. ML14260A200). The scope can be described as follows:

The review of the CEUS SSC catalog published in NUREG-2115 focused on to two issues:

1) Identification of additional reservoir induced seismicity (RIS) earthquakes in the southeastern US, and 2) Locations of earthquakes in South Carolina near the time of the 1886 Charleston, SC earthquake sequence. Several additional RIS events were identified in the catalog and a number of South Carolina earthquakes were re-characterized as Charleston earthquake aftershocks.

Further processing of the updated earthquake catalog was performed using the same procedures as performed in EPRI 1021097 including Magnitude evaluations, de-clustering, and completeness calculations.

The update did not consider the impact of earthquakes after the time period covered by Version 7.0 of the CEUS-SSC Catalog; however, those earthquakes will be considered as part of our Recommendation 2.1 PRA efforts. provides, in table form, the control point seismic hazard curves for Oconee Nuclear Station, Units 1, 2 and 3 in relation to Version 7.0 of the CEUS-SSC Catalog. provides, in table form, the control point seismic hazard curves for Oconee Nuclear Station, Units 1, 2 and 3 in relation to the CEUS-SSC Catalog regional update used for the Recommendation 2.1 Seismic Hazard Reevaluation.
